Discovering the Enchantment of "An Idyll" by Albert Joseph Moore

Artistic Vision: The Inspiration Behind "An Idyll"

Exploring the Themes of Serenity and Nature

Albert Joseph Moore's "An Idyll" captures a serene moment in nature, inviting viewers into a tranquil world. The painting reflects themes of peace, harmony, and the beauty of the natural environment. Moore's work often emphasizes the connection between humanity and nature, showcasing idyllic scenes that evoke a sense of calm.

Moore's Unique Approach to Classical Beauty

Moore's artistic vision blends classical beauty with a modern sensibility. He draws inspiration from ancient Greek and Roman art, infusing his work with a timeless elegance. This approach allows "An Idyll" to resonate with audiences, as it embodies both historical reverence and contemporary relevance.

Visual Elements: A Deep Dive into the Composition

Color Palette: The Harmony of Soft Hues

The color palette of "An Idyll" features soft, muted tones that create a soothing atmosphere. Gentle greens, delicate pinks, and warm earth tones harmonize beautifully, enhancing the painting's tranquil mood. This careful selection of colors invites viewers to immerse themselves in the peaceful scene.

Figures and Forms: The Graceful Depiction of Women

In "An Idyll," Moore masterfully depicts graceful female figures, embodying beauty and femininity. The women are portrayed in flowing garments, their poses exuding elegance and poise. This focus on the female form highlights Moore's admiration for classical ideals and the celebration of womanhood.

Symbolism in "An Idyll": Nature and Femininity

The painting is rich in symbolism, intertwining themes of nature and femininity. The lush surroundings represent fertility and growth, while the women symbolize nurturing and grace. This connection emphasizes the importance of women in the natural world, reflecting Victorian ideals of femininity.

Historical Context: The Victorian Era and Its Influence

Art Movements: The Aesthetic Movement's Role

"An Idyll" emerged during the Victorian era, a time marked by the Aesthetic Movement. This movement celebrated beauty for its own sake, influencing artists like Moore to prioritize visual pleasure. The painting exemplifies this philosophy, showcasing exquisite detail and harmonious composition.

Moore's Place Among Contemporary Artists

Albert Joseph Moore was a prominent figure among his contemporaries, including Edward Burne-Jones and James Whistler. His unique style and dedication to beauty set him apart, allowing him to carve a niche in the art world. Moore's contributions to the Aesthetic Movement continue to inspire artists today.

Technique and Style: The Mastery of Oil Painting

Brushwork and Texture: Capturing Light and Shadow

Moore's technique in "An Idyll" showcases his mastery of oil painting. His brushwork creates a rich texture, capturing the interplay of light and shadow. This skillful application of paint adds depth and dimension, making the scene come alive with vibrancy.

Comparative Analysis: Moore vs. His Peers

When compared to his peers, Moore's focus on serene beauty and classical themes stands out. While artists like Burne-Jones explored darker narratives, Moore maintained an optimistic outlook. This distinction highlights his unique contribution to the art of the Victorian era.
